Paulette Suchy Obituary

Mary Paulette Suchy (Donaldson), age 80, was born on January 2nd, 1945 in Pipestone, Minnesota and ran into the arms of Jesus in Lakeland, Florida on November 20th, 2025.

Paulette was a living example of the miraculous and an unashamed witness for Jesus. She lived her entire life to walk out faith and to declare the goodness of God. A trip to the grocery store that should only take about an hour usually turned into three because God would put someone in her path that needed to hear from Him. And she was never afraid to pray for someone or encourage them on the spot in those moments. If you went to any church with her, she would walk down the aisle and greet people, making them feel welcome and declaring that 'God is gonna bless your socks off!'

Paulette had several health issues that ultimately led to her passing, and while we were not prepared to let her go this soon, God had other plans and we trust Him.

Paulette was proud to be a 'navy brat', whose father served and eventually retired as a Naval Officer and cryptologist for the United States Navy. She so often shared stories about life on the military base, shenanigans by her sister swinging from a chandelier in the officer's club, and living in Guam during their military life.

Paulette loved to talk about her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ren and loved them deeply. She loved to sing. She had professional vocal training and performed with an opera company in Washington D.C. where she sang for President Linden B. Johnson. She spent many summers in New York at Summer Stock and performed in many Off Broadway musicals. More recently, she served her church in Michigan faithfully for years as a choir director and vocalist and right up until her illness here in Florida could be heard out-singing all of those around her. She loved to lift her voice to the Lord in worship.

She is preceded in death by her parents, Paul and Ihla Donaldson and her granddaughter Caraline Singh. Those that are waiting to join her someday are her husband, Michael Suchy, sisters Janet (Jim) O'kunze, Lynn Chillano, daughters Becki (Steve) Rose, Jaime (Paul) Lederman, and Abby (Bobby) Singh, grandsons Ryan (Rachel) Rose, Tim (Rachel) Rose, Morgan (Andrew) McBride, Ethan, Josee and Eli Lederman, Sophia and Austin Singh, great-grandchildren Rayden and Robbi Rose and Beck and Della McBride.
